Abstract
The objective was to provide the average planning group with a usable tool that would impart a systematic procedure for analyzing the water and sewerage networks of a regional metropolitan area. Six procedures were constructed, using three computer models: the inventory and data projection procedure which provides the input; the population model which generates the desirable alternatives in terms of people and their socio-economic characteristics; the land use procedure which allocates the output of the population model to an areal scheme; the demand model and procedure which produces the water demand and sewage output for the given areal scheme; the network model and procedure which optimizes on a least cost basis, while maximizing utilization of resources, the networks of water and sewerage to fulfill the alternatives available, and finally the plan procedures for the development of a continuing and comprehensive plan. The model was developed using data from the Association of Central Oklahoma Governments.
